O que é Base de Dados?

A base de dados, também conhecida como banco de dados, é um conjunto organizado de informações relacionadas entre si, armazenadas de forma estruturada em um sistema computacional. Essas informações podem ser de diversos tipos, como textos, números, imagens, vídeos, entre outros, e são utilizadas para armazenar e gerenciar dados de forma eficiente.

Importância da Base de Dados

A base de dados é essencial para empresas e organizações que precisam armazenar e gerenciar grandes quantidades de informações. Ela permite o armazenamento seguro e estruturado dos dados, facilitando o acesso e a manipulação das informações de forma rápida e eficiente.

Além disso, a base de dados é fundamental para a tomada de decisões estratégicas, uma vez que fornece informações precisas e atualizadas sobre clientes, produtos, vendas, entre outros aspectos relevantes para o negócio.

Tipos de Base de Dados

Existem diferentes tipos de base de dados, cada um adequado para diferentes necessidades e aplicações. Alguns dos principais tipos são:

1. Base de Dados Relacional

A base de dados relacional é a mais comum e amplamente utilizada. Nesse tipo de base de dados, as informações são organizadas em tabelas, onde cada tabela representa uma entidade e cada linha representa uma instância dessa entidade. As tabelas são relacionadas entre si por meio de chaves primárias e chaves estrangeiras, permitindo a integração e a consulta dos dados de forma eficiente.

2. Base de Dados Hierárquica

A base de dados hierárquica organiza as informações em uma estrutura hierárquica, onde cada registro possui um único registro pai e pode ter vários registros filhos. Esse tipo de base de dados é mais utilizado em aplicações que possuem uma estrutura hierárquica bem definida, como sistemas de arquivos.

3. Base de Dados de Rede

A base de dados de rede é uma evolução da base de dados hierárquica, onde os registros podem ter múltiplos registros pais e múltiplos registros filhos. Esse tipo de base de dados é utilizado em aplicações que possuem relacionamentos complexos entre os dados.

4. Base de Dados Orientada a Objetos

A base de dados orientada a objetos é utilizada para armazenar e gerenciar objetos, que são instâncias de classes em uma linguagem de programação orientada a objetos. Esse tipo de base de dados é mais utilizado em aplicações que utilizam programação orientada a objetos.

5. Base de Dados NoSQL

A base de dados NoSQL, ou não relacional, é utilizada para armazenar e gerenciar grandes volumes de dados não estruturados, como documentos, gráficos, séries temporais, entre outros. Esse tipo de base de dados é mais utilizado em aplicações que requerem alta escalabilidade e flexibilidade.

Funcionamento da Base de Dados

A base de dados funciona por meio de um sistema de gerenciamento de banco de dados (SGBD), que é responsável por controlar o acesso, a manipulação e a segurança dos dados. O SGBD permite a criação, a atualização, a exclusão e a consulta dos dados de forma organizada e eficiente.

Além disso, a base de dados utiliza uma linguagem de consulta, como SQL (Structured Query Language), para realizar operações nos dados, como inserção, atualização, exclusão e consulta. Essa linguagem permite a interação entre os usuários e a base de dados, facilitando a manipulação das informações.

Vantagens da Base de Dados

A utilização de uma base de dados traz diversas vantagens para empresas e organizações, como:

1. Organização e Estruturação dos Dados

A base de dados permite a organização e a estruturação dos dados de forma eficiente, facilitando o acesso e a manipulação das informações. Isso torna mais fácil a localização e a recuperação dos dados quando necessário.

2. Segurança dos Dados

A base de dados oferece mecanismos de segurança para proteger os dados contra acessos não autorizados e garantir a integridade das informações. Isso inclui controle de acesso, criptografia, backups e recuperação de dados.

3. Rapidez e Eficiência no Acesso aos Dados

A base de dados permite o acesso rápido e eficiente aos dados, mesmo quando se trata de grandes volumes de informações. Isso facilita a tomada de decisões e agiliza os processos internos da empresa.

4. Integração e Compartilhamento dos Dados

A base de dados possibilita a integração e o compartilhamento dos dados entre diferentes sistemas e aplicações. Isso permite a troca de informações entre áreas da empresa e facilita a colaboração entre equipes.

Conclusão

A base de dados é uma ferramenta fundamental para empresas e organizações que lidam com grandes volumes de informações. Ela permite o armazenamento, o gerenciamento e o acesso eficiente aos dados, contribuindo para a tomada de decisões estratégicas e o sucesso do negócio. É importante escolher o tipo de base de dados adequado às necessidades da empresa e contar com um sistema de gerenciamento de banco de dados eficiente para garantir a segurança e a eficiência das informações.